Background technology
Power battery currently used for electric vehicle mainly has Ni-MH battery and lithium ion battery, and with lithium electricity industry Fast development, lithium battery new-energy automobile, energy storage field, consumer electronics field etc. application it is increasingly extensive, lithium ion battery with Working voltage platform height, energy density high (theoretical specific capacity reaches 3860mAh/g), non-environmental-pollution, operating temperature range are wide Extensively, the advantages that self-discharge rate is low, memory-less effect, efficiency for charge-discharge are high, long lifespan obtains the extensive approval of people, becomes new one For the ideal power source of electric vehicle.
Wherein, aluminum-shell battery compares soft-package battery security performance higher, in aluminum-shell battery manufacturing process, many technological requirements Safeguard construction is higher.In battery pole ear block welding, ultrasonic bonding, electric resistance welding or Laser Welding mode are generally used.It is existing Have in technology, when cell polar ear welds, mostly uses ultrasonic welding, and welding positioning accuracy is poor, be easy rosin joint, be partially welded, lug Weldering, which is split etc., causes product quality problem, influences the efficiency and quality of battery core exploitation.
Laser Welding have welding efficiency is high, heat-affected zone is small, with workpiece is non-contact, to facilitate realization automated production etc. special Point has become the preferred welding manner of welding battery industry.Laser Welding belongs to precision welding mode, generally to workpiece itself The positioning accuracy request of tolerance and fixture is relatively high.The fixture of Laser Welding is typically necessary needs according to the shape of workpiece come specially Door design, main to consider two aspect of positioning and clamping, welding fixture is more demanding to clamping force, and workpiece holds in laser beam welding Thermal deformation easily occurs, needs fixture with certain clamping force to offset part thermal stress, prevents workpiece from deforming, but clamping force Also it should not be too large, otherwise can cause to occur situations such as undercut.
In view of the deficiencies in the prior art, it is necessary to which a kind of new fixture for battery laser welding is provided.

The workflow of above-mentioned battery welding clamp comprises the steps of:
S1. cover plate assembly 14 is fixed by interspersed be seated at card slot 7 of first segment groove 161,
S2. in the first cavity 16 on pedestal 1 placing battery core 12, visually core 12, lug 13 with lid Whether plate positive and negative anodes connection sheet position is appropriately adjusted, before and after adjusting core 12 by adjusting the position of the baffle 3 Position;
S3. after the relative position adjustment for waiting for core 12 and cover plate assembly 14, by hinge 11 by pedestal 1 and pressing plate 2 Pressing, and pressing plate 2 is fastened equipped with lock handle 9 with the lock 10 on pedestal 1, and then fixed entire core 12;
S4. after the locking of pressing plate 2, heat-resisting partition board 15 is inserted into the partition board card slot 8 that pressing plate 2 is equipped with, protects Laser Welding Core 12 will not be burnt out when connecing because of abnormal spark;
S5. the tabletting 6 that pedestal 1 is equipped with is depressed at lug 13, by laser welding, completes lug 13 and connect with positive and negative anodes The welding of contact pin;
S6. tabletting 6 is removed out successively, takes out heat-resisting partition board 15, opens pressing plate 2, finally takes out the core 12 being welded and lid Board group part 14.
